Rowan Atkinson (a.k.a. Mr. Bean) crashed his $1 million McLaren F1 on Thursday, unjuring his shoulder when his car hit a tree and a lamp post on the A605 in Haddon, Cambridgeshire, England. The car then caught on fire.

Rowan Atkinson was able to walk away from the crash all on his own, and was then kept company by a passing motorist until fire and rescue crews arrived. Crews from the Cambridgeshire Fire and Rescue Service brought the fire under control, and Mr. Bean took a trip to the hospital. Thankfully, he was released the next day.

The McLaren F1 is one of the world's fastest cars, with a top speed of 231 mph with its rev limiter on, and 240 mph with its rev limiter removed. Atkinson's McLaren F1 was on of only about 65 in existence worldwide.

Jaycee Lee Dugard, who was a blond, ponytailed, 11-year-old girl when she was abducted right in front of her stepfather as she headed to a school bus stop 18 years ago, has finally made her way to freedom, and is soon to be reunited with her parents.

The woman walked into a San Francisco Bay area police station and said she was Jaycee Lee Dugard, the girl who had been kidnapped 18 years ago. And thankfully, it doesn't seem to be just some misguided loony claiming to be the kidnapped girl. According to Lt. Les Lovell of the El Dorado Sheriff's Department, they're actually about 99% sure that it's her.

Her family has been contacted, and they're currently in the process of arranging a meeting. Carl Probyn, Jaycee Lee Dugard's stepfather, said that the news was "like winning a lottery." I'll bet! Wow, can you imagine how happy they must feel right now?! I'm majoryly hyped just knowing about it!

Update: Jaycee Lee Dugard (not Kaycee Lee Dugard, for those who've been misspelling it) was reunited with her mother, who was overjoyed to learn that her daughter, who she thought was dead, was actually alive and well. :)

Arrest of the Lowlife Scumbags

And as if this story couldn't get any better, the authorities have also arrested the two lowlife scumbags, 58-year-old Phillip Garrido and his 54-year-old wife Nancy Garrido, who are suspected of being the kidnappers.


According to Yahoo! News, "Phillip Garrido is also being held for investigation of rape by force, lewd and lascivious acts with a minor and sexual penetration, said Jimmie Lee, a spokesman for the Contra Costa Sheriff's Department.

Phillip Garrido has a conviction for rape by force or fear, and was paroled from a Nevada state prison in 1999, according to the California Department of Corrections and Rehabilitation."


Apparently, California corrections officials called Phillip Garrido in for questioning on Wednesday after they received a report that he had been seen with two small children at the University of California in Berkeley. When he arrived, he was accompanied by two children and two adult women.

According to Yahoo! News: "The diligent questioning and follow-up by the parolee's agent of record led to Garrido revealing his kidnapping of the adult female," the department said in a statement. "It was further revealed by Garrido that she was Jaycee Lee Dugard, and that the children were his."

Update: Law enforcement officials now believe that Jaycee Lee Dugard was kept in a shed and used a sex slave for Phillip Garrido and his wife Nancy Garrido. Assholes. Jaycee apparently became pregnant several times during her captivity and had at least two children. Those children made Garrido's parole officer suspicious, which led to his arrest.

Breaking News: The "King of Pop" is gone. It appears that pop icon Michael Jackson has just died at the age of 50, just weeks before his planned comeback tour in which he was scheduled to perform 50 sellout concerts to over a million people in London's O2 arena.

At 12:26 p.m. today paramedics were called to his home in Bel Air, Los Angeles, California. When they arrived he was unresponsive and not breathing. Paramedics performed c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) and he was rushed to the hospital...due to an apparent cardiac arrest.

A short while later it was reported that he arrived at the hospital in a deep coma and that his family was at his bedside.

A.I.G. Planning Huge Bonuses After $170 Billion Bailout

WASHINGTON — The American International Group (AIG), which has received more than $170 billion in taxpayer bailout money from the Treasury and Federal Reserve, plans to pay about $165 million in bonuses by Sunday to executives in the same business unit that brought the company to the brink of collapse last year.

Word of the bonuses last week stirred such deep consternation inside the Obama administration that Treasury Secretary Timothy F. Geithner told the firm they were unacceptable and demanded they be renegotiated, a senior administration official said. But the bonuses will go forward because lawyers said the firm was contractually obligated to pay them.

The payments to A.I.G.’s financial products unit are in addition to $121 million in previously scheduled bonuses for the company’s senior executives and 6,400 employees across the sprawling corporation. Mr. Geithner last week pressured A.I.G. to cut the $9.6 million going to the top 50 executives in half and tie the rest to performance. Continue to article

So what happens when you charge people $599 for the most advanced iPhone model, then unexpectedly slash the price by $200 in an effort to boost holiday sales? You have to say iSorry!

After receiving hundreds of email complaints, Apple CEO Steve Jobs wrote a letter acknowledging that they upset customers by cutting the price of the iPhone's 8-gigabyte model from $599 to $399, and apologized for disappointing them.

Apple also agreed to offer every iPhone customer who purchased an iPhone from Apple or AT&T, and who isn't receiving a rebate or any other consideration, a $100 store credit towards the purchase of any product at an Apple Retail Store or the Apple Online Store.
